test/integration: add RHEL-8.2 integration tests

Patches rebased against RHEL-8.2 GA kernel-4.18.0-193.el8.

Tests disabled for errors when building against updated
4.18.0-193.3.1.el8_2.x86_64 z-stream kernel:

Subject: [PATCH] kpatch module integration test
This tests several things related to the patching of modules:
- 'kpatch_string' tests the referencing of a symbol which is outside the
.o, but inside the patch module.
- alternatives patching (.altinstructions)
- paravirt patching (.parainstructions)
- jump labels (5.8+ kernels only) -- including dynamic printk
